Frequently Asked Questions about Tooele County

What type of rentals are currently available in Tooele County?

There are currently 41 Apartments for Rent in Tooele County, UT with pricing that ranges from $799 to $2,500. There are also 46 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Tooele County ranging from $650 to $3,895.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Tooele County?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Tooele County ranges from $650 to $3,895 with an average monthly rent of $1,936.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Tooele County?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Tooele County range from $1,699 to $2,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,270 to $2,465.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,200 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,199.
